I really don't know where you read they don't make AutoFlowering Offspring when inbred pure. ...PLEASE LINK... Autoflowering is a reccessive trait and if your stain is 100% AF you will be 100% AF offspring, it is a genetic trait that can be locked down, just takes awhile. Now if you cross an Pure 100% AF strains with a NON-AF strain your offspring will more then likely be NON-AF due to the reccessive nature of the AutoFlowering gene.

So ya breed them pure and you will have Diesel Ryder seeds. Most should look like the parents you used,, Most pure AFs are very stable, once again due to the reccessive nature of the AF trait.,, As the breeder is locking down the AF trait he is also locking down many other traits aswell, so you can be sure your stock is good for breeding new stock for future use.
